I stopped collecting trading cards sometime around 2005-2006. In 2008 or '09 me and my friend bought and split an assorted lot of sports cards at the local card shop, and that was the last time I bought or thought about sports cards, until last month.

My peak collecting years were 1999-2003, when I was 11-15 years old.
I mostly just traded with friends and worked on my personal collection. But in 2005-06 I used the internet and sold some of my collection, for poker money. I can't remember the site I posted on, but it was always cash in the mail + SASE.


Back then I remember everyone trusting in Beckett. I loved the magazines of course, but by 05-06 they had a good online database built, and I knew the Beckett Value of all my cards.



Now my question, are the Beckett prices still relevant and meaningful?

Ive been looking through this forum for a couple weeks now, and I never see the BV mentioned, and a lot of cards I see for sale on here, have asking prices that dont sync up at all with the BV.
I understand sales history and recent COMPS are the most common way to determine value, but I am just wondering how Becketts pricing is regarded in todays market.
